About Cod Liver Oil

Cod Liver Oil is a nonvolatile oil obtained by pressing the fresh livers of cod and other codfish species.[1] Because it primarily contains fatty components from cod liver, it mixes better with oils than with water and is suitable for adding slip and a soft, supple feel to skin or hair while reducing the feeling of moisture evaporating quickly. In cosmetics, it is used to prevent the characteristic odor or flavor of raw materials from becoming overly noticeable, to leave the skin surface feeling soft and smooth, and to protect the skin from external factors.[2]
